您好,请问一下这个函数什么意思:nLeft = *(int*)recvText

这个函数什么意思nLeft = *(int*)recvText 请教一下这句话什么意思??VC6.0

不负相思意
浏览 201回答 1
1回答

万千封印

nLeft=*(int*)recvText从以上代码来看nLeft应该是int型的变量recvText是一个非int型的指针这句话的意思是把recvText指向的4个字节的内容的值赋值给nLeft比如:charrecvText[]={0xFF,0xFF,0x00,0x00};intnLeft=*(int*)recvText;对,就是把前4个字节的大小给nLeft
打开App,查看更多内容
随时随地看视频慕课网APP